The highly anticipated film Superboys of Malegaon is all set to take audiences on an inspiring cinematic journey, with the official release date now confirmed for February 28th. Directed by the talented Reema Kagti, this heartwarming story is based on the lives of Nasir Shaikh and the other amateur filmmakers from the small town of Malegaon, who, against all odds, create magic on the big screen. The film draws inspiration from the 2008 documentary Supermen of Malegaon, which introduced the world to these unsung heroes of filmmaking.
After its world premiere at the prestigious 2024 Toronto International Film Festival in the Gala section, Superboys of Malegaon has already garnered widespread attention. With a stellar cast led by Adarsh Gourav, Vineet Kumar Singh, Shashank Arora, Riddhi Kumar, Muskkaan Jaferi, and Manjiri Pupala, the film beautifully captures the spirit of creativity and resilience that defines the filmmakers of Malegaon. Superboys of Malegaon is set to hit cinemas on February 28th, 2025. After its theatrical release, it will be available for streaming on Amazon Prime Video, making it accessible to audiences worldwide.
